How does a teacher apply Tyler's model in the classroom?

A teacher can apply Tyler's model by identifying specific learning outcomes, designing a curriculum that aligns with these outcomes, implementing instructional strategies to achieve the outcomes, and assessing student learning based on the desired outcomes. This approach helps to ensure clarity of goals, alignment of instruction, and assessment of student achievement.

What are potential problems in classifying music as classical folk or popular music?

Classifying music as classical, folk, or popular can be problematic due to the fluid nature of musical genres and the overlap between them. For example, elements of classical music can be found in popular genres, and folk music often incorporates contemporary influences. Additionally, cultural context plays a significant role in defining these categories, making it difficult to apply a one-size-fits-all classification. This can lead to misinterpretation and underappreciation of diverse musical forms.
